"The Department of Family and Consumer Sciences (KK) was officially established on January 10, 2005 in accordance with the Decree of the Chancellor of IPB No. 01/OT/V2005. The IKK Department is one of the departments under the Faculty of Human Ecology IPB. The IKK Department has a mandate for the development of science and technology in the field of families and consumers to realize family welfare by focusing on developing the quality of children and empowering families and consumers.In 2013 the IKK Department received A accreditation according to BAN PT decision No 227/SK/BAN-PT/Ak-XVI/S/ XI/2013 for the period 2013-2018 Based on law No. 12 of 2012 concerning higher education, article 10 paragraph 2 that the IKK Department belongs to the applied sciences group, namely the Science and Technology family that examines and explores the application of science to human life. The Department of Family and Consumer Sciences consists of three divisions, namely 1) The Division of Family Sciences, which is a division that focuses on the development of successful family sciences the goal for the resilience of family functions as a social institution; 2) Child Development Division, which is a division that builds relevant science and technology for holistic child development, involving physical-motor, social-emotional, cognitive ability, and moral character development to create a quality generation; 3) Division of Consumer Science and Family Economics, namely the division that develops family behavior in allocating resources owned based on the principles of consumer science and economics in order to improve family welfare. "Becoming a leading and international standard study program in developing science and technology in the field of families and consumers to improve family welfare in various agroecological areas".
Mission"1. Organizing higher education in the fields of family science, child development, and consumers. 2. Organizing quality research as a contribution to the development of science and technology and solving family, child, and consumer problems in various agroecological areas. 3. Organizing community service and development of cooperation to increase family resilience, quality of children, and empower consumers in various agroecological areas."
